/*  
 *	@doc INTERNAL
 *
 *	@module	HYPH.CPP -- Hyphenation class |
 *
 *	A table which holds the non-standard hyphenation cases. We store
 *	these entries in the table because we cache the results of hyphenation
 *	in our CLine structure, storing the actual WCHAR and khyph would cost
 *	4 bytes. With this mechanism we can use 5 bits.
 *
 *
 *	Several elements are reserved:
 *	0 - No hyphenation
 *	1 - Normal hyphenation
 *	2 - Delete before
 *
 *	All other ones contain a khyph and a WCHAR.
 *	If performance is an issue, this table could be sorted and binary
 *	searched. We assume this table typically has few entries in use.
 *	
 *	Owner:<nl>
 *		Keith Curtis:	Created
 * 
 *	Copyright (c) 1995-1999, Microsoft Corporation. All rights reserved.
 */
